UWM’s STAR program seeks to help fill that gap by preparing students from underrepresented backgrounds for graduate training and careers in aging and public health. The UWM STAR program is a multi-year, cohort-based program that matches students from underrepresented backgrounds with mentors to conduct research in aging and health disparities. It is based on successful programs developed by UWM’s Office of Undergraduate Research (OUR) directed by Nigel Rothfels over the last 20 years. Karyn Frick will co-direct UW-Milwaukee Promoting Equity, Diversity, and Academic Success Through Aging Research Program (STAR) program.
